Nursing Programs

Palliative care and end-of-life content are integrated throughout the University of Rochester School of Nursing’s undergraduate and graduate nursing curricula in clinical, ethical, policy, and theory coursework. In addition, the School of Nursing offers a hospice and palliative care elective. Students have the opportunity to interact with members of the palliative care team, attend palliative care rounds, and investigate palliative care and hospice care as delivered at home and in institutional settings.
